40-595A-001 -
Pickering Interfaces Ltd.
The 40-595A is a matrix module based on the BRIC format that is designed for fault insertion applications in safety critical testing. As with other BRIC modules the matrix size can be scaled to suit the user application. The 40-595 has a very high current rating of 10 Amps, ideal for higher power systems, and can be used as a conventional matrix.

Hitex GmbH
Testing a complete system is very different from unit and integration test. It starts with the V model that defines the system requirements, and this needs an effective system test capability that includes both the system and the environment around it. If the system has interfaces to the outside world, communications links or human control, these interfaces have to be tested.

H261 -
Howell Instruments, Inc.
The H261 Series Temperature Indicator Tester provides accurate testing of the calibration and operation of temperature indicators. This is achieved by simulating thermocouples, resistance temperature devices, and other millivolt transducers. These testers also troubleshoot thermocouples and millivolt sources by measuring their outputs. In addition, they measure thermocouple circuit resistance and harness insulation resistance.
